In the world of engineering and technology, various tools and devices are employed to enhance functionality and efficiency. One such essential tool is the turning device, which plays a crucial role in numerous applications, from manufacturing to robotics. A turning device refers to any apparatus that allows for the rotation or turning of an object around an axis. This can include simple mechanisms like levers and pulleys, as well as more complex machines such as lathes and CNC (Computer Numerical Control) machines.The significance of the turning device in manufacturing cannot be overstated. In factories, for instance, lathes are widely used to shape materials by rotating them against cutting tools. This process is vital in producing components with precise dimensions, such as shafts, bolts, and gears. Without the aid of a turning device, achieving the level of accuracy required in modern engineering would be exceedingly difficult.Moreover, turning devices are not limited to industrial applications. They also find extensive use in everyday life. For example, household items like door knobs and steering wheels are forms of turning devices. These simple mechanisms allow users to exert control over their environment, demonstrating how integral turning devices are to our daily activities.In the realm of robotics, turning devices are pivotal in enabling movement and interaction with the surroundings. Robots often utilize motors and gears that function as turning devices to perform tasks such as picking up objects, navigating spaces, or assembling products. The development of advanced turning devices has significantly enhanced the capabilities of robots, making them more versatile and efficient in various sectors, including healthcare, manufacturing, and logistics.As technology continues to evolve, the design and functionality of turning devices are also advancing. Engineers are constantly seeking innovative ways to improve these devices, making them more compact, energy-efficient, and capable of handling a wider range of tasks. For instance, the integration of smart technology into turning devices allows for real-time monitoring and adjustments, further increasing their effectiveness.In conclusion, the turning device is an indispensable element in both industrial and everyday contexts. Its ability to facilitate rotation and movement makes it a fundamental component in various applications, from manufacturing to robotics. Understanding the importance and functionality of turning devices helps us appreciate the intricacies of modern technology and its impact on our lives. Whether we realize it or not, these devices play a significant role in shaping the world around us, enhancing both productivity and convenience in our daily routines.
